Latest Patents
Chandrasekhar's latest patents include a "System for interference mitigation in a satellite communication system" and a "System to determine pulse per second timing." The first patent addresses the issue of self-interference among user terminals (UTs) accessing a constellation of satellites. It introduces a method for resource mapping to allocate link resources effectively, thereby reducing or eliminating self-interference. The second patent focuses on accurate timing for satellite communication, allowing user terminals to generate an alternate pulse per second (PPS) signal when external timing sources are unavailable. This innovation ensures reliable communication even in challenging conditions.
